    The Critical Exponent is Computable for Automatic Sequences

    The critical exponent of an infinite word is defined to be the supremum of the exponent of each of its factors. For k-automatic sequences, we show that this critical exponent is always either a rational number or infinite, and its value is computable. Our results also apply to variants of the critical exponent, such as the initial critical exponent of Berthe, Holton, and Zamboni and the Diophantine exponent of Adamczewski and Bugeaud. Our work generalizes or recovers previous results of Krieger and others, and is applicable to other situations; e.g., the computation of the optimal recurrence constant for a linearly recurrent k-automatic sequence.Comment: In Proceedings WORDS 2011, arXiv:1108.341

    Factors Related to Healing Process of Sectio Caesarea Surgical Wound

    ABSTRACT Sectio caesarea surgical wound is a disorder in the incontinence of cells due to surgery performed to remove the fetus and placenta by opening the abdominal wall for certain indications. The aim of the study was to analyze and make a modeling of the relationship of factors in healing the sectio caesarea surgical wounds. This research is an analytic observational study with cross-sectional design. The sample in this study were 42 mothers with post sectio caesarea surgery at Prof. DR. W.Z. Johannes Kupang Public Hospital. Sampling was performed by simple random sampling. Data analysis was carried out in a bivariate and multivariate analysis. The results of the bivariate analysis found that the variables that give risk to wound healing were age (p = 0.041; RP = 3.4), discharge planning (p = 0.004; RP = 4.75), personal hygiene (p = 0.003; RP = 0.18), nutritional status (p = 0.013; RP = 0.15). Multivariate analysis found three variables that consistently provide risks to wound healing, namely discharge planning (p = -2.078; RP = 829 95% CI), personal hygiene (p = -1.852; RP = 1.039 95% CI), nutritional status (p = -2,374; RP = 1,023 95% CI). Probability model for healing the surgical wound at Prof. Dr. W.Z. Johannes, namely personal hygiene, nutritional status, discharge planning are factors related to wound healing.     RESEARCHES ON AUTOMATION OF DOSING AND SACKING PROCESS OF FINISHED AGRICULTURAL PRODUCTS

    Researches whose results are presented in this paper are on the topic of optimizing the dosing and sacking process in small and medium capacity productive units..The technological equipment for weighing and automated management EWAM, developed at INMA Bucharest performes simultaneously two operations: automated bag weighing of the programmed quantity of product and automated management of the quantities of sacked finished products on an indefinite period of time.In this paper there are presented the experimental researches for this equipment, working quality indices determined with highlighting the advantages of using this type of technical equipment in the flow of small and medium capacity milling units in villages

    A SURVEY REGARDING THE NEWEST SEEDLINGS PLANTING TECHNOLOGIES THAT CAN BE USED IN AGROFORESTY, LANDSCAPE ECOLOGY AND FOREST REGENERATION FIELDS

    Nowadays the seedlings planting technologies are design to raise mechanization performance on forestry and pomiculture works. Their impact is manly on soil remediation, lowering the surface and depth erosion degree, capitalization of rainwater, lowering the dust pollution and natural calamity risk and the rehabilitation of inland flora. In this paper will be presented some of the most performant planting technologies, which can be used in the environmental management process that assures high establishment rate. In some cases, the ecological benefits can occur after a shorter period of time reducing considerably the calamity risks, encouraged the inland flora, forest and degraded the site restauration, but also landscape ecology.Â

    Impact of Visceral Leishmaniasis on Local Organ Metabolism in Hamsters.

    Leishmania is an intracellular parasite with different species pathogenic to humans and causing the disease leishmaniasis. Leishmania donovani causes visceral leishmaniasis (VL) that manifests as hepatosplenomegaly, fever, pancytopenia and hypergammaglobulinemia. If left without treatment, VL can cause death, especially in immunocompromised people. Current treatments have often significant adverse effects, and resistance has been reported in some countries. Determining the metabolites perturbed during VL can lead us to find new treatments targeting disease pathogenesis. We therefore compared metabolic perturbation between L. donovani-infected and uninfected hamsters across organs (spleen, liver, and gut). Metabolites were extracted, analyzed by liquid chromatography-mass spectrometry, and processed with MZmine and molecular networking to annotate metabolites. We found few metabolites commonly impacted by infection across all three sites, including glycerophospholipids, ceramides, acylcarnitines, peptides, purines and amino acids. In accordance with VL symptoms and parasite tropism, we found a greater overlap of perturbed metabolites between spleen and liver compared to spleen and gut, or liver and gut. Targeting pathways related to these metabolite families would be the next focus that can lead us to find more effective treatments for VL
